Psalm 26
I have trusted the Lord to bring me out of my troubles;
Forgive my sins; I follow you way; I am innocent;
I sing to You songs of thanksgiving and my foot stands on
Your level ground; I will worship you with the congregation.

Colossians 1
Paul writes to a church and greets them; he is pleased with their
Faith for it is bearing much fruit; a fellow minister, Epaphras, is
praised for the work he has done among them; may your faith take
you through everything that you might inherit the light and kingdom of
His beloved son.

Matthew 3
John the Baptist condemns the professional religious of the day for
Repentance is at hand; Another is coming and I am not worthy of
Him; John baptizes with water but this One will baptize with the
Holy Spirit and fire and He will gather His own to Him.

Collect of the Day | Third  Sunday of Easter
O God, whose blessed Son made himself known to his disciples in the breaking of bread:
Open the eyes of our faith, that we may behold him in all his redeeming work;
who lives and reigns with you, in the unity of the Holy Spirit, one God,
now and forever. Amen.
